Samsung Galaxy A15: Impressive Features & Premium Design
The Samsung Galaxy A15 is designed to offer smooth performance, stunning visuals, and reliable software support, making it one of the best budget smartphones in India.
📱 Super AMOLED Display with High Brightness
- 6.5-inch Full HD+ Super AMOLED panel for vivid colors and sharp details.
- 90Hz refresh rate, ensuring smooth scrolling and gaming.
- 1000 nits peak brightness, making the display clear and bright, even in sunlight.
- Dewdrop notch design for an immersive viewing experience.
⚡ Powerful Processor & Performance
- Exynos 1280 / MediaTek Dimensity 6100+ (Processor may vary by variant) – Both offer reliable performance in this segment.
- Android 14 OS with One UI 6, providing a user-friendly and feature-rich experience.
- Up to 8GB RAM & 256GB internal storage, with expandable storage support.
🔄 Long-Term Software Support
- 4 years of OS upgrades for extended usability.
- 5 years of security updates, ensuring long-term protection.
Samsung Galaxy A15: Massive Battery & Fast Charging
🔋 5000mAh battery for all-day power.
⚡ 25W fast charging – Charge your device quickly and stay connected.
🔄 Battery optimization ensures longer battery life over time.
With Samsung’s power-efficient software, users can expect extended battery life even with heavy usage.
Samsung Galaxy A15: AI-Enhanced Camera for Everyday Photography
📸 Triple Rear Camera Setup:
- 50MP Primary Sensor – Captures detailed and high-quality images.
- 5MP Ultra-Wide Lens – Perfect for landscape and group shots.
- 2MP Depth Sensor – Enhances portrait mode and background blur effects.
🤳 Front Camera:
- 13MP Selfie Shooter – Ideal for video calls and social media photography.
With Samsung’s AI-powered image processing, the Galaxy A15 ensures crisp and clear photos in all lighting conditions.
Samsung Galaxy A15: 5G Connectivity & Smart Features
📶 5G Network Support – Future-proofed for fast and stable connectivity.
📡 Wi-Fi & Bluetooth for seamless wireless connections.
🔌 USB Type-C Port & 3.5mm Headphone Jack, catering to both wired and wireless audio users.
🌐 GPS for accurate navigation.
Samsung Galaxy A15: Pricing & Availability in India
The Samsung Galaxy A15 is now available in three storage variants, making it accessible to users with different needs.
💰 Pricing Details:
📌 6GB + 128GB – ₹17,999 (₹16,499 effective price after bank discount)
📌 8GB + 128GB – ₹19,499
📌 8GB + 256GB – ₹22,499
📅 Availability: The Samsung Galaxy A15 is available for purchase on Samsung’s official website, Amazon, Flipkart, and leading retail stores.
🎨 Color Options:
✔️ Blue Black
✔️ Blue
✔️ Light Blue
